什么是css,在网页中有什么作用

CSS(Cascading Style Sheets)是一种样式表语言,用于描述网页的布局、外观和风格。
它通过控制文本宽度、颜色、间距等元素,实现内容和样式的分离管理。
CSS 在网页中的主要作用是分离内容和样式。
CSS 将网页的结构(HTML)和呈现(样式)分开。
开发者可以直接通过修改CSS文件来调整页面的外观,而无需更改HTML代码。
例如修改全局字体或颜色时,只需要编辑CSS规则,不需要逐页修改HTML标签属性。
这种分离简化了维护,特别适合大型网站或者需要频繁更新样式的场景。
确保风格的一致性。
通过外部样式表或内部CSS样式规则,可以统一控制整个网站的字体、颜色、布局等元素。
例如,选择全局文本样式后,所有页面将自动继承相同的背景颜色、默认字体和其他属性。
避免代码重复,减少因手动设置各页面样式而导致的样式不一致。
提高网页的可访问性 CSS 通过调整文本大小、颜色对比度、行间距和其他属性来支持改善残障人士的浏览体验。
例如:使用font-size:1 .2 em放大文字,方便视障人士阅读;使用颜色:#000000 和背景颜色:#FFFFFF 设置高对比度颜色匹配,以提高可读性;使用 width: none 隐藏不必要的装饰元素,减少视觉干扰。
通过将其与 ARIA(可访问的富互联网应用程序)功能相结合,CSS 可以进一步提高屏幕阅读器的兼容性。
实现CSS响应式设计可以让网页通过媒体查询(MediaQueries)和灵活布局(Flexbox/Grid)根据设备屏幕尺寸自动调整布局。
例如:移动端隐藏侧边栏(@media(max-width:7 6 8 px){.sidebar{display:none;}});使用flex-wrap:wrap使卡片容器自动换行成窄屏幕;以视口单位(例如 vw/vh)动态缩放元素。
确保网页在台式机、平板电脑、移动电话和其他设备上提供一致的用户体验。
提高网页性能并减小文件大小:CSS 集中管理样式,避免 HTML 中多余的内联样式,从而减小文件大小。
例如,外部 CSS 文件可以替换数百个样式属性。
加速渲染:浏览器会缓存CSS文件,用户再次访问时无需重新下载,减少加载时间。
精简代码:使用CSS预处理器(如Sass/Less)或模块化开发,进一步压缩代码大小,提高执行效率。
控制CSS文本的实际应用示例:使用字体系列:“Arial”、sans-serif调整字体,并使用line-height:1 .5 设置行高。
布局管理:使用width:flexible创建灵活的容器,或者使用position:absolute实现精确定位。
动画效果:使用transition:all0.3 sease 添加平滑的过渡动画,或使用@keyframes 定义复杂的动画序列。
切换主题:使用 CSS 变量(--primary-color:#4 2 8 5 F4 )一键切换网站主题的颜色。
总结:CSS作为网页设计的基本语言,通过内容与风格分离、统一视觉风格、增强可访问性、支持响应式布局、提高性能等方式,极大地提高了网页的开发效率和用户体验。
无论是静态页面还是动态应用,CSS都是实现美观、高效、兼容前端的关键工具。

从0.1开始学习CSS - 0 什么是CSS?

CSS 是一种用于级联样式表的 Web 语言,主要用于描述 HTML 文件的表示。
网页的构成详解:网页是指我们平时在网页浏览器上看到的各种界面。
HTML(超文本标记语言)是一种标记语言,用于描述网页内容的结构,如文本、图像、音频等。
CSS构建了网页的样式,决定了内容的显示方式,包括颜色、布局、字体等。
CSS的作用:CSS的主要作用是通过给HTML元素添加样式来美化网页,使网页更漂亮、更易于使用。
样式可以包括颜色、字体、边距、对齐方式、背景图像等属性。
基本CSS语法:CSS语法的结构相对简单,通常包括选择器、属性和值。
选择器用于指定要应用样式的 HTML 元素。
属性用于描述要改变的样式的特征,例如颜色、字体大小等。
值是属性期望的具体行为,例如红色、1 6 像素等。
CSS示例:在HTML文件中,可以通过